Gospel Kazako is the Chairperson of the Electricity Supply Corporation of Malawi (ESCOM), where he has been vocal about the need for Independent Power Producers (IPPs) to fulfill their commitments promptly. He has expressed frustration over delays in the implementation of power agreements, emphasizing that while signing contracts is a positive step, the real challenge lies in delivering reliable and accessible energy to the Malawian people.
